Unlocking the Power of Consensus: Exploring Unanimous Shareholders’ Agreements

In the world of business, decision-making and maintaining unity among shareholders can be a challenging task. This is especially true when multiple stakeholders are involved in a company’s operations and decision-making processes. However, with the help of unanimous shareholders’ agreements (USAs), businesses can effectively unlock the power of consensus among shareholders, ensuring smoother operations and enhanced decision-making.

A unanimous shareholders’ agreement is a legally binding and comprehensive contract that all shareholders of a company agree to. It outlines the rights, obligations, and responsibilities of each shareholder and establishes a framework for decision-making. What sets USAs apart from regular shareholders’ agreements is their requirement for unanimous consent on important matters. This means that major decisions must have the approval of all shareholders involved, ensuring that everyone is in agreement before moving forward.

The use of unanimous shareholders’ agreements offers numerous benefits for businesses and their shareholders. One significant advantage is the ability to protect minority shareholders’ rights. In many cases, minority shareholders may lack influence or control in a company’s decision-making processes. However, with a unanimous shareholders’ agreement, these shareholders can ensure that their voices are heard and that their rights are protected. By requiring unanimity on important matters, minority shareholders can gain equal footing in shaping critical decisions that impact the company’s future.

Furthermore, USAs can help maintain continuity and prevent potential conflicts among shareholders. By setting detailed guidelines on how certain decisions are to be made, a unanimous shareholders’ agreement can provide a roadmap for resolving disputes or disagreements. This framework encourages open communication and collaboration, reducing the likelihood of conflicts escalating and negatively impacting the business.

Additionally, USAs can protect the interests of shareholders in the event of a sale or transfer of shares. In these situations, having a unanimous shareholders’ agreement in place can ensure that all shareholders receive fair compensation and have a voice in the decision-making process. This can be particularly crucial when dealing with a potential acquisition or merger, as it allows all stakeholders to actively participate and protect their investment.

Moreover, unanimous shareholders’ agreements can help businesses plan for the unexpected. These agreements can include provisions for events such as the death or incapacitation of a major shareholder. By addressing these scenarios in advance, USAs can minimize the potential disruption caused by such occurrences, allowing the business to continue smoothly and seamlessly.

While unanimous shareholders’ agreements offer many benefits, they may not be suitable for all businesses. The decision to implement a unanimous shareholders’ agreement should be carefully considered, with shareholders evaluating the specific needs and dynamics of their company. Seeking legal advice is crucial to ensure that the agreement aligns with the local legal framework and the specific requirements of the business.

In conclusion, unanimous shareholders’ agreements are powerful tools that can unlock the potential of consensus among shareholders. By establishing clear guidelines and requiring unanimous consent on important matters, these agreements protect the rights of minority shareholders, maintain unity, and assist in resolving conflicts. As businesses navigate complex decision-making processes, USAs provide a framework that enables collaboration, ensuring the company’s continued success.
